Auto-Normalmode:
In Auto mode the gearchangeismanagedcompletelyautomaticallybythe transmission electronic controlsystem. The controlunitdeterminesenginespeedand moment ofthe shiftaswellasitsspeed, basedon parameters suchasvehiclespeed, enginespeedand the driver's requestfortorqueand power. In AUTO mode a gear can alsoberequested manuallythroughthe paddlesbehindthe steeringwheel(gearsuggestion).
The system recognisesthe typeofdriver by meansoffunctionsthatassessthe driver's style ofdrivingthroughlateraland longitudinalaccelerationand acceleratorpedal movement. Ifa sportierdrivingstyle isrecognised, the "UP" shiftsare movedtoa higher numberofenginerevs. The controlsystem alsorecognisesthe typeofroad, adapting gearchangeswhenthe road climbsor falls, on a bend, in townand on motorways.
AUTO NORMAL mode isthe mode mostdesignedforcomfort: changingtoa highergear isrequiredassoonaspossiblein ordertoobtainthe lowestlevelofvibrationsand acousticreturnfromthe engine. Shiftingis managedin sucha way astoensurethatgear changesare ultra-smooth. Thismode alsoensureslowerfuelconsumptionwhen combinedwitha normaland non-aggressivedrivingstyle. Thisdoesnotmean, however, havingtogiveup on the car's sportynature: duringsports driving, withfrequentopening ofthe throttle, gearshiftspeedsapproachthoseofthe AUTO SPORT mode.
In AUTO mode, the engagedgearwillbeindicatedon the info display on the instrument cluster.
Auto-Sport mode:
AUTO SPORT mode isactivatedwiththe transmissionin auto mode and bypressing the SPORT buttonlocatedon the centredashboard: gearchangingisstillmanaged automaticallybythe transmissioncontrolunit, butbyvaryingthe speedofthe operations toopen up and reduce torque, disengage, selectand engage gear, closethe clutchand restoreenginetorque. The resultisa fastergearchangeand a more sportydrivingfeel.
ComparedtoAUTO NORMAL mode, shifting up takesplaceat higherenginespeeds, whereasmovingdown a gearisaccompaniedbya more pronounceddoublede-clutching effect.
Icemode:
Thismode can beusedon particularlyslipperyroad surfaces(snow, ice), or more generallyin low-gripconditions. Itisactivatedthroughthe ICE buttonlocatedon the centretunnel. Whenswitchedon, the system avoidshavingtorunthe engineat more than 3,000 rpm.
ICE mode takespriorityoverSPORT and MSP OFF modes: thismeansthatwhenthe driver requeststhe ICE mode, Sport mode isdeactivatedautomatically(ifitwason) and the stabilitycontrol(MSP) restored(ifpreviouslydeactivated).
Automatic mode with Easy-exit:
The default configuration of the gearbox is Automatic mode. If requested, the Auto mode can be switched off (and Manual mode activated) by pushing the “Auto”button on the centre console.
If the engine is switched of with the gearbox in Manual mode, atthe next engine start the system will activate the “Automatic with Easy-exit”configuration. This configuration will last for two minutes during which the “Auto”indication on the info display will flash. If during this period while the car is driving a gear is selected manually, the gearbox will exit the Auto mode en go to Manual mode. If during this time no gearchangerequest is made, the gearbox will go to Auto mode.
Note: forwhatconcernsthe “Sport”and “Ice”modes, at enginerestartthe robotized gearboxconfigurationisthe sameaswhenthe enginewasswitchedoff.
4. BrakingSystem
The Maserati GranTurismoS isfittedwitha high-performancebrakesystem, whichuses dual-casttechnologyforthe frontbrakediscs, developedin collaborationwithBrembo and usedforthe first timein the automotivefield on the Maserati Quattroporte Sport GT S. In contrasttoconventionalcast-irondiscs, the dual-castdisc consistsofa cast-iron brakingring and analuminiumhub, making itpossibletocombine the advantagesoffered bycast iron's performance at temperature withthe aluminium's light weight.
At the front, the dual-castdiscs(360 x 32 mm) are combinedwithsix-pistonaluminium monoblocbrakecalipersofdifferentiateddiameter(30/34/36 mm), withFerodo HP1000 pads. The monobloccalipersare more resistanttodeformationthancalipersmadeoftwo parts; thismeansthatlightermaterials, in thiscase aluminium, can beusedand componentweightminimisedevenfurther. The caliperisalsomore efficientat any operatingpressureand thistranslatesintolighteruseofthe pedalusewhenbraking.
At the rear, 330 x 28 mm discs are fittedwith4-piston calipersofdifferentiateddiameter (32/36 mm), and Jurid673 GG pads.
The brakecalipersfittedasstandard on the Maserati GranTurismoS are red. The customermaypersonalisethe colourofthe calipersbyselectingfromoneofa further5 alternative shades: Titaniumand Yellow fora more sportylook, Silver and Bluefora more elegantconfiguration, or the classicBlack.
The brakingsystem in the Maserati GranTurismoS alsofeaturesABS, whichpreventsthe wheelsfromlockingup whenbraking, and EBD forbetterdistributionofbrakingforce betweenthe frontand rearwheels, bothintegratedwithMSP Bosch version8.0.

6. Suspensions and Wheels
Single-ratingsportssuspensiontoenhancethe sportydrivingfeel
The Maserati GranTurismoS offersthe samesuspensionlayout asthe 4.2 L engine version. However, italsofeaturesa specialdevelopmentdesignedtoreallyexploit the greaterpoweroutput ofthe 4.7 V8 and harnessthe capabilitiesofferedbythe Transaxle system.
The Maserati GranTurismoS isfittedasstandard withfixed-ratingsteel dampersmodified withthe introductionofnewspringsand dampers, whichoffer10% more dampingforce and are repositionedin termsofcompression/extensionratioso as tomatch the car's differentspecification. The diameterofthe reartorsionbar hasalsobeenincreasedto makeitmore rigid.
Thesemodificationshaveresultedin a 10% reductionin body rollwhich, combinedwith the excellentweightdistribution, makesthe Maserati GranTurismoS particularlyagile and responsivetodriver instructions: in a successionofbendsitappearsquickand intuitive whenenteringand findingthe centreofthe bendand speedywhennegotiatingthe bend. Furthermore, the driver can accelerate earlierwhencomingout ofthe benddue tothe reducedloadtransfers.
As analternative tothe standard fixed-ratingsuspension, the Maserati GranTurismoS maybeprovided, uponrequest, withSkyhookelectronic controlsuspensionsfeaturing aluminiumbody damperswithcontinuousdampingvariation; in thiscase the hardware modificationsare accompaniedbyspecialmanagement software.

Optional Skyhooksuspension:
The Skyhookelectronic suspensionmanagement system isabletocontinuouslymonitor the suspensiondamping: the system actsthroughaccelerationsensorswhichrecord the movementsofeachwheeland thusensurethatanysurfaceunevennessisabsorbedand the highestlevelofcomfort guaranteed.
A furtheradvantageofthe Skyhookelectronic suspensioncontrolsystem isthatthe driver can choosefromtwodifferentsettings: Normal, whichallowstravelwiththe highestlevel ofdrivingcomfort, and Sport, whichgivesa harderride settingwithmore reducedroll anglesand loadtransfers, therebyenhancingthe agilityand stabilityofthe carbody. In the Sport configurationthe handlingofthe Maserati GranTurismoS iscomparablewith thatguaranteedbyfixed-ratingdampers.

Parking sensors
Withthe ignitionkey in the ON position, the frontand rearparking sensorsare activated automaticallywhenreverse gearisengaged.
Ifthe carisequippedwithfrontsensors, thesesensorscan beactivatedbypressing button A; whenthe frontsensorsare active, the buttonisbacklitwithanamberlight. To switchoff the frontsensors, press A once again. Allthe sensorsremainactivewhen reverse gearisdisengaged. The rearsensorsremainactivefor60 secondsuntilthe vehiclespeedreachesaround18 km/h. The frontsensorsremainactiveuntilthe vehicle speedreachesaround18 km/h (11 mph). On activationofthe frontor rearsensors, a beeper warnsthe driver thatthe system is active. Whenthe sensorsare on, the system beginsemittingbeepsassoonasanobstacleisdetected. The beepfrequencyincreases asthe vehicleapproachesthe obstacle. The beepsare emittedfromtwobeepers, one locatedunder the dashboard(ifthe vehicleisequippedwithfrontsensors) and onenearto the luggagespace(ifthe vehicleisequipped withrearsensors). Whenthe obstacleisless than35 cm fromthe bumper, a continuousbeepisemitted. The beepstopsimmediatelyif the distancefromthe obstacleincreases.
The tone cyclesremainconstantifthe distancemeasuredbythe centralsensorsremains unchanged. Howeverifthe samesituation occurswiththe side sensors, the beepis interruptedafter7 seconds, toavoidcontinuousbeepingwhenmanoeuvringalonga wall, forexample.
The distancefromthe obstaclescan alsobe viewedon the instrumentpanelbymeansof a graphicdisplay, whichshowsthe vehiclesurroundedbysymbolsindicatingthe detected obstacle's distance(maximum, medium and minimum distance) and position (front/rear, central/side). The colourrepresentsthe distance, the fieldrepresentsthe position. The maximumdetecteddistanceisdisplayedin green, the medium in yellow and the minimum in red. Ifthe vehicleisonlyequippedwithrearsensors, the frontsensorsare omittedfrom the graphicdisplay. Ifthe vehicleisequippedwithfrontand rearsensorsand onlythe frontsensorsare active, the rearsensorsare omittedfromthe graphicdisplay.
Stop &Gofunction
The carisequippedwitha Stop &Gofunction, whichcan beactivatedbymeansofthe Multimedia System. The Stop &Gofunction can beenabled/disabledfromthe “Setup” menu, byselectingthe option“Definevehicle parameters”, selectingthe Stop&Goparking optionand changingthe settingto"ON". With the Stop &Gofunctionactive, the front sensorsare automaticallyactivatedwhenever the vehiclespeeddropsbelow18 km/h (11 mph).
WARNING: The Stop&Gofunctionisonlyavailablewhenfrontparking sensorsare installed.
The sensorsenablethe system tomonitor the frontand back ofthe vehicle; theirposition coversthe medianand side zonesofthe vehicle, bothat the frontand rearends. Ifan obstacleislocatedin the medianzone, itisdetectedat distancesoflessthan0.9 m tothe frontand 1.5 m tothe rear, accordingtothe typeofobstacleand in proportiontoits dimensions. Ifthe obstacleispositionedin the side zone, itisdetectedat distancesofless than0.8 m.
